Commit in java/trunk/tracking/src/main/java/org/hps/recon/tracking on MAIN
ShapeFitParameters.java+26-30912 -> 913
ShaperAnalyticFitAlgorithm.java-1912 -> 913
ShaperLinearFitAlgorithm.java-1912 -> 913
+26-32
3 modified files
remove unused tp/tpErr fields in ShapeFitParameters

java/trunk/tracking/src/main/java/org/hps/recon/tracking
ShapeFitParameters.java 912 -> 913
--- java/trunk/tracking/src/main/java/org/hps/recon/tracking/ShapeFitParameters.java	2014-08-26 23:13:08 UTC (rev 912)
+++ java/trunk/tracking/src/main/java/org/hps/recon/tracking/ShapeFitParameters.java	2014-08-26 23:21:58 UTC (rev 913)
@@ -1,7 +1,3 @@
-/*
- * To change this template, choose Tools | Templates
- * and open the template in the editor.
- */
 package org.hps.recon.tracking;
 
 import org.lcsim.event.GenericObject;
@@ -16,8 +12,8 @@
     private double _t0Err = Double.NaN;
     private double _amp = Double.NaN;
     private double _ampErr = Double.NaN;
-    private double _tp = Double.NaN;
-    private double _tpErr = Double.NaN;
+//    private double _tp = Double.NaN;
+//    private double _tpErr = Double.NaN;
     private double _chiSq = Double.NaN;
 
     public ShapeFitParameters() {
@@ -36,9 +32,9 @@
         _amp = amp;
     }
 
-    public void setTp(double tp) {
-        _tp = tp;
-    }
+//    public void setTp(double tp) {
+//        _tp = tp;
+//    }
 
     public void setAmpErr(double _ampErr) {
         this._ampErr = _ampErr;
@@ -48,9 +44,9 @@
         this._t0Err = _t0Err;
     }
 
-    public void setTpErr(double _tpErr) {
-        this._tpErr = _tpErr;
-    }
+//    public void setTpErr(double _tpErr) {
+//        this._tpErr = _tpErr;
+//    }
 
     public void setChiSq(double _chiSq) {
         this._chiSq = _chiSq;
@@ -64,9 +60,9 @@
         return _amp;
     }
 
-    public double getTp() {
-        return _tp;
-    }
+//    public double getTp() {
+//        return _tp;
+//    }
 
     public double getT0Err() {
         return _t0Err;
@@ -76,9 +72,9 @@
         return _ampErr;
     }
 
-    public double getTpErr() {
-        return _tpErr;
-    }
+//    public double getTpErr() {
+//        return _tpErr;
+//    }
 
     public double getChiSq() {
         return _chiSq;
@@ -100,14 +96,14 @@
         return object.getDoubleVal(3);
     }
 
-    public static double getTp(GenericObject object) {
-        return object.getDoubleVal(4);
-    }
+//    public static double getTp(GenericObject object) {
+//        return object.getDoubleVal(4);
+//    }
+//
+//    public static double getTpErr(GenericObject object) {
+//        return object.getDoubleVal(5);
+//    }
 
-    public static double getTpErr(GenericObject object) {
-        return object.getDoubleVal(5);
-    }
-
     public static double getChisq(GenericObject object) {
         return object.getDoubleVal(6);
     }
@@ -124,7 +120,7 @@
 
     @Override
     public int getNDouble() {
-        return 7;
+        return 5;
     }
 
     @Override
@@ -148,11 +144,11 @@
                 return _amp;
             case 3:
                 return _ampErr;
+//            case 4:
+//                return _tp;
+//            case 5:
+//                return _tpErr;
             case 4:
-                return _tp;
-            case 5:
-                return _tpErr;
-            case 6:
                 return _chiSq;
             default:
                 throw new UnsupportedOperationException("Only 7 double values in " + this.getClass().getSimpleName());

java/trunk/tracking/src/main/java/org/hps/recon/tracking
ShaperAnalyticFitAlgorithm.java 912 -> 913
--- java/trunk/tracking/src/main/java/org/hps/recon/tracking/ShaperAnalyticFitAlgorithm.java	2014-08-26 23:13:08 UTC (rev 912)
+++ java/trunk/tracking/src/main/java/org/hps/recon/tracking/ShaperAnalyticFitAlgorithm.java	2014-08-26 23:21:58 UTC (rev 913)
@@ -91,7 +91,6 @@
         fit.setAmpErr(Math.sqrt(height_var));
         fit.setT0(t0);
         fit.setT0Err(Math.sqrt(time_var));
-        fit.setTp(constants.getTp());
 
         double chisq = 0;
         for (int i = 0; i < samples.length; i++) {

java/trunk/tracking/src/main/java/org/hps/recon/tracking
ShaperLinearFitAlgorithm.java 912 -> 913
--- java/trunk/tracking/src/main/java/org/hps/recon/tracking/ShaperLinearFitAlgorithm.java	2014-08-26 23:13:08 UTC (rev 912)
+++ java/trunk/tracking/src/main/java/org/hps/recon/tracking/ShaperLinearFitAlgorithm.java	2014-08-26 23:21:58 UTC (rev 913)
@@ -83,7 +83,6 @@
         fit.setChiSq(min.fval());
         fit.setT0(times[0]);
         fit.setT0Err((t0err.lower() + t0err.upper()) / 2);
-        fit.setTp(constants.getTp());
 
         // System.out.format("%f\t%f\t%f\t%f\t%f\t%f\n", samples[0] - constants.getPedestal(),
         // samples[1] - constants.getPedestal(), samples[2] - constants.getPedestal(), samples[3] -
SVNspam 0.1